Transaction 6628d177480ced677683a742288f12c177ae352face28f7087d25d0f21b29dd3
1 Input
1 Output
-
6628d177480ced677683a742288f12c177ae352face28f7087d25d0f21b29dd3:0
- value
- 82148725
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c31b2051642e4c6118bb6ac244823332917d22e OP_EQUALVERIFY OP_CHECKSIG
- address
- 13a5TGWqeERKB56tuJF9Dny9xZRCvJxdP7